cookie是储存在用户本地终端上的数据。 在我们登陆网站时有记录密码,也有时间限制比如说7天,5天等等这都是我们利用cookie来写的, 这就是利用了cookie的会话周期,但cookie同时又是不安全的我们可以打开网页看到用户输入的密码,而且又是依赖于服务器环境的, 再写cookie时还要设置储存路径,而我们获取出来的值又是字符串,同时它又是非常小的,只有4kb, 下面我们来封装一下coookie 封装设置cookie: function setCookie(name,value,iDay) { //传值为名,值,过期时间 if(iDay){ //如果有过期时间的话则执行这个条件 var oDate=new Date(); //获取当且的事件戳 oDate.setDate(oDate.getDate()+iDay); //设置过期事件 document.cookie=name+"="+value+"; path=/; expires="+oDate;//设置cookie }else {//如果有过期时间的话则执行这个条件 设置cookie document.cookie=name+"="+value+"; path=/"; //名,值以及根目录 }}获取cookie值function getCookie(name) { var arr1=document.cookie.split("; "); 获取cookie值并且用”; “来进行切割成数组 for(var i=0;i<arr1.length function></arr1.length>
免责声明:本站内容仅用于学习参考,信息和图片素材来源于互联网,如内容侵权与违规,请联系我们进行删除,我们将在三个工作日内处理。联系邮箱:chuangshanghai#qq.com(把#换成@)